Just in time to spoil your New Year’s Resolution, badge-covered vest wearing Girl Scouts arrive at your door with their brilliant fundraising idea — cookies.  Thin Mints, Samoas, Tagalongs: You know you can’t resist. If you haven’t placed your order yet this year, better hurry. More than 2.6 million Girl Scouts in the United States will be turning in their cookie orders soon. And while you’re looking forward to receiving your cookies sometime in weeks that follow, its also worth reflecting on the storied past of these iconic cookies. The entrepreneurial cookie initiative dates back a whole lot further than you might expect. So listen up and earn your merit badge for the day with these 10 facts about Girl Scout cookies. 1. Home baked business In 1917, just five years after Juliette Gordon Low founded the Girl Scouts in Savannah, Georgia, the Mistletoe Troop in Muskogee, Oklahoma decided to sell cookies…

Just because you’re vegan, doesn’t mean you can’t indulge. More people are attempting vegan lifestyles than ever before. Living the vegan way means no dairy, eggs, meat, honey, leather or anything that’s a byproduct of animals, but the number of vegan products and substitutes is on the rise, making the switch easier than ever. But just because you’re vegan doesn’t mean you have to get excited over celery sticks when your friends are savoring Sour Patch Kids. Life would be way less fun if you could never share in snacking with friends or family. Here are a handful of acceptable vegan treats — only because they’re animal-friendly (definitely no health claims here).
